Ingredients for Your Creamy Tuscan Delight
This recipe serves 4-6 and requires minimal prep time, making it ideal for those weeknights when you crave something delicious but don't have hours to spare. Gather your ingredients and let's get cooking!
Ingredient | Quantity |
---|---|
Boneless, Skinless Chicken Breasts | 1.5 lbs (about 680g), cut into bite-sized pieces |
Olive Oil | 1 tbsp |
Garlic, minced | 2 cloves |
Sun-dried Tomatoes, oil-packed, drained and sliced | 1/2 cup (about 70g) |
Heavy Cream | 1 cup (about 240ml) |
Chicken Broth | 1/2 cup (about 120ml) |
Grated Parmesan Cheese | 1/4 cup (about 25g), plus more for serving |
Fresh Spinach | 5 oz (about 140g), roughly chopped |
Dried Italian Herbs | 1 tsp |
Salt and Black Pepper | To taste |
Pasta of your choice (fettuccine, penne, etc.) | 1 lb (about 450g) |
Instructions: Creating Your Creamy Tuscan Masterpiece
- Cook pasta according to package directions until al dente. Drain and set aside.
- While the pasta cooks, heat olive oil in a large skillet over medium-high heat. Add the chicken and cook until browned and cooked through, about 6-8 minutes. Season with salt and pepper. Remove the chicken from the skillet and set aside.
- Reduce heat to medium. Add garlic and sun-dried tomatoes to the skillet and cook for 1 minute, until fragrant.
- Pour in the heavy cream and chicken broth. Bring to a simmer, then stir in the Parmesan cheese and Italian herbs. Cook for 2-3 minutes, until the sauce has thickened slightly.
- Add the spinach and cook until wilted, about 2 minutes.
- Return the chicken to the skillet and stir to coat with the sauce.
- Add the cooked pasta to the skillet and toss to combine.
- Serve immediately, garnished with additional Parmesan cheese.
Expert Tips and Flavor Variations
Elevate your Creamy Tuscan Chicken Pasta with these simple tweaks:
- Spice it up: Add a pinch of red pepper flakes to the sauce for a little kick.
- Veggie boost: Substitute the spinach with kale or other leafy greens.
- Creamy variations: Use half-and-half instead of heavy cream for a lighter sauce. You can also add a touch of cream cheese for extra richness.
